Clomiphene Citrateis a medication commonly used to treat infertility in women. It works by stimulating the release of hormones that help to induce ovulation and improve the chances of conception in women who are struggling with infertility. Clomiphene citrate is a selective estrogen receptor modulator (SERM) that belongs to the class of drugs known as selective estrogen receptor modulators (SERMs). The medication is commonly used in the treatment of ovulatory dysfunction, helping to induce ovulation in women with polycystic ovary syndrome (PCOS), hypogonadism, and other conditions. It works by stimulating the release of hormones from the pituitary gland, which in turn stimulates the growth and release of follicles in the ovaries. It is also commonly used as a fertility treatment option, particularly for women with polycystic ovary syndrome (PCOS) who are struggling to conceive. Clomid (Clomiphene Citrate) is a trusted medication in the reproductive field, known for its ability to encourage the release of hormones necessary for ovulation. This medication is typically prescribed for women who do not ovulate regularly. By simulating a natural increase in hormone production, Clomid helps to ensure that the ovaries release one or more eggs during the cycle.- When to Take Clomid? It's essential to follow your doctor's instructions when taking Clomid. Typically, the course starts early in the menstrual cycle and continues for five days. The exact timing can vary depending on individual health conditions and the specific advice of your healthcare provider.- Who Can Benefit? Clomid is particularly effective for women diagnosed with Polycystic Ovary Syndrome (PCOS) or other ovulatory disorders. It’s a beacon of hope for those who struggle with irregular ovulation, helping to restore normal cycles and increase the likelihood of conception.
